  • MEGA - Episode 11 - EU Competitiveness_ A New Compass for Economic Dynamism
    2025/04/06

    The European Commission's "EU Competitiveness Compass" outlines a strategy to revitalize Europe's economic standing by addressing innovation gaps, promoting a joint path for decarbonization and competitiveness, and reducing strategic dependencies. This communication identifies longstanding structural weaknesses hindering the EU's growth, particularly in productivity and technological advancement compared to global competitors. To counter this, the Compass proposes a new competitiveness model centered on innovation-led productivity, supported by actions across three key pillars and horizontal enablers. These include fostering a thriving innovation ecosystem, ensuring a competitiveness-friendly green transition, and enhancing economic security through diversified partnerships and reduced reliance on vulnerable supply chains. Ultimately, the document serves as a strategic guide for the EU to regain its economic dynamism, safeguard its social model, and assert its global influence in a challenging geopolitical landscape.

  • MEGA - Episode 10 - IMF Report Europe's Productivity Weakness
    2025/03/30

    This IMF working paper investigates the causes behind Europe's lagging productivity growth compared to the United States. Through firm-level analysis, the authors identify performance gaps in both leading and young, high-growth European companies. The paper highlights smaller market sizes and limited access to equity financing as key obstacles for larger firms, while skill shortages and insufficient venture capital hinder the development of startups. Ultimately, the study suggests that deeper market integration and national reforms aimed at resource reallocation and human capital enhancement could revitalize Europe's productivity.

  • Boosting EU Competitiveness Beyond 2030
    2025/01/19

    This European Commission communication addresses the EU's long-term competitiveness beyond 2030. It examines current challenges, including weaker productivity growth compared to other major economies and increasing reliance on global supply chains. The communication proposes nine key drivers to enhance competitiveness, focusing on strengthening the single market, boosting investment, improving infrastructure, fostering innovation, ensuring affordable energy, promoting a circular economy, driving digitalization, developing skills, and strengthening trade. The document also emphasizes the need for a growth-enhancing regulatory framework and utilizes key performance indicators to monitor progress across these areas. Finally, it calls for joint action from businesses and policymakers to secure the EU's future economic prosperity.

  • EU-US Competitiveness: A Widening Gap
    2025/01/12

    Today we analyze a recent Elcano Royal Institute report that analyzes the widening competitiveness gap between the EU and the US. Using nine key performance indicators from the European Commission and additional metrics. The authors assess EU performance in areas such as the single market, access to capital, public investment, R&D, energy, digitalization, and education. The analysis reveals significant EU weaknesses, particularly in digitalization and R&D spending, while highlighting relative strengths in renewable energy and trade surpluses. The report also examines factors like productivity, regulatory burdens, and company size contributing to the disparity. Finally, it concludes with observations on the need for improved EU policies and a more efficient public sector to bridge the gap.

  • McKinsey Global Institute: Accelerating Europe Competitiveness for a new era
    2024/12/22

    This McKinsey Global Institute article assesses Europe's competitiveness in a new geo-economic era. While Europe excels in sustainability and inclusion, its economic growth lags behind the United States, creating a significant prosperity gap. The authors identify seven key areas impacting competitiveness—innovation, energy, capital, supply chains, talent, size, and competition—and propose ambitious, albeit challenging, goals to address these weaknesses. These goals necessitate higher investment, strategic policy changes, and collaboration between businesses and policymakers. The ultimate aim is to boost Europe's economic performance while maintaining its commitment to sustainability and inclusion.
